What Is Package Detection on Smart Doorbells? Quick Answer
Package detection on smart doorbells is an artificial intelligence feature that automatically identifies when a delivery package arrives at your front door. The doorbell’s camera uses advanced computer vision algorithms to recognize boxes, envelopes, and parcels. When a package is detected, the system sends you an instant alert on your smartphone, even if you’re away from home. This technology helps prevent package theft and ensures you know exactly when deliveries arrive. Unlike standard motion detection, package detection specifically targets delivery items rather than triggering alerts for every passing person or vehicle.

How Does Package Detection Technology Actually Work?
Package detection relies on sophisticated artificial intelligence and computer vision technology built directly into your smart doorbell. The camera captures high-resolution video feeds continuously. Advanced neural networks analyze each frame to identify package-like shapes, sizes, and characteristics.
The system learns from millions of images during training to recognize delivery packages accurately. When the AI detects an object matching package parameters, it classifies the detection and triggers an alert. Modern doorbells process this analysis locally on the device, protecting your privacy by keeping video data secure.

Local Processing vs. Cloud Analysis
Premium smart doorbells process package detection locally on the device itself. This approach offers significant privacy advantages since video analysis happens without sending footage to remote servers. Local processing also reduces latency, delivering alerts faster to your phone.
Some budget-friendly models rely on cloud processing where video uploads to manufacturer servers for analysis. Cloud-based detection may offer slightly better accuracy due to access to larger computational resources. However, this method raises privacy concerns for homeowners concerned about video storage and data security.

How Can You Set Up and Optimize Package Detection?
Installing package detection begins with proper smart doorbell placement. Position your doorbell at a height where it captures your entire porch and package drop zones. Ensure adequate lighting, as poor visibility reduces detection accuracy. Clean the lens regularly to maintain optimal image quality for AI analysis.
Most smart doorbells allow you to customize package detection sensitivity through their mobile app. Lower sensitivity reduces false alerts but may miss some deliveries. Higher sensitivity catches more packages but increases notifications for non-delivery items like mail or newspaper deliveries.
Installation and Positioning Best Practices
- Mount the doorbell 48-60 inches high for optimal porch coverage.
- Position it to capture the entire package delivery area without obstructions.
- Ensure adequate outdoor lighting or use the doorbell’s built-in night vision.
- Test detection accuracy during your first week by ordering test packages.
- Clean the camera lens monthly to prevent dust from affecting image quality.
Customizing Sensitivity and Alert Settings
Fine-tuning your package detection settings prevents alert fatigue while ensuring you catch important deliveries. Most apps let you adjust sensitivity levels on a scale from low to high. Start with medium sensitivity and adjust based on your actual experience over two weeks.
Create custom notification rules that differentiate package alerts from motion detection. You might want package alerts on your phone immediately while saving motion alerts to review later. Some systems allow scheduling, disabling package detection during certain hours when you’re home and can monitor arrivals manually.

What Are the Limitations and Challenges?
Package detection technology, while impressive, has real limitations worth understanding. The system sometimes struggles with unusual package shapes, extremely small envelopes, or packages placed in unexpected locations. Weather conditions like heavy rain or snow can reduce detection accuracy by obscuring visual details.
False negatives occur when the AI fails to detect actual packages, usually due to poor lighting, unusual packaging, or obstructed views. False positives happen when the system misidentifies other objects as packages. Neither scenario is ideal, though false negatives present greater concerns since you might miss deliveries entirely.
Common Detection Failures and Their Causes
- Small envelopes and padded mailers often go undetected by basic AI models.
- Packages placed far from the door may fall outside the detection zone.
- Night deliveries sometimes fail when lighting is insufficient for accurate analysis.
- Non-standard packaging like soft bags or irregular shapes confuse detection algorithms.
- Temporary obstructions like vehicles or furniture blocking the porch reduce accuracy.
Privacy Considerations and Data Security
Cloud-based package detection requires uploading video to manufacturer servers, raising legitimate privacy concerns. Even with encryption, some users prefer not storing video data outside their home. Local processing eliminates this concern but may offer slightly lower accuracy in some scenarios.
Review your doorbell manufacturer’s privacy policy carefully before enabling package detection. Understand how long they retain video data, who can access it, and whether they use it for training AI models. Some manufacturers anonymize video for training purposes while others delete all footage immediately after analysis.

Frequently Asked Questions
Does package detection work at night or in low light?
Package detection works in low light using the doorbell’s night vision capabilities, but accuracy decreases compared to daytime. Most smart doorbells use infrared technology to capture images in darkness. However, the AI may struggle to identify packages as clearly without natural light. Adequate outdoor lighting significantly improves nighttime detection accuracy and is worth installing if you receive frequent evening deliveries.
Can package detection distinguish between different types of deliveries?
Most package detection systems identify any package-like object but cannot distinguish between packages from different carriers or retailers. Some advanced models attempt to recognize branded packaging, but this remains unreliable. The primary function is simply alerting you that something arrived, not identifying what specifically was delivered. You’ll still need to check the package or tracking information to confirm contents.
Does package detection require a subscription or additional fees?
Many smart doorbell manufacturers include basic package detection as a free feature. However, advanced package detection capabilities, cloud storage of detection events, or integration with premium services sometimes require paid subscriptions. Always check the pricing structure before purchasing, as some brands charge monthly fees for features you might expect to be included. Compare subscription costs across brands when evaluating total cost of ownership.
How accurate is package detection compared to human monitoring?
Modern package detection achieves 90-99% accuracy depending on the model and conditions, approaching human-level performance in ideal situations. However, humans excel at recognizing unusual packages or items placed in unexpected locations. The best approach combines automated detection with occasional manual review of footage. Package detection excels at catching standard deliveries while humans handle edge cases the AI misses.
Can I disable package detection if it sends too many false alerts?
Yes, most smart doorbells allow you to completely disable package detection or adjust sensitivity settings. If you’re receiving excessive false alerts, start by lowering sensitivity rather than disabling the feature entirely. Many users find that reducing sensitivity to low or medium eliminates most false alerts while still catching genuine deliveries. You can always enable it again if you adjust settings and find better accuracy.
Is package detection affected by weather conditions?
Heavy rain, snow, or fog can reduce package detection accuracy by obscuring visual details or reducing image clarity. Extreme heat can sometimes affect camera performance temporarily. Most doorbells handle light rain and normal weather without issues. During severe weather, manually monitoring your porch or asking a neighbor to check for packages provides better reliability than depending solely on automated detection.
